Your team

You will be part of the Web & Digital Division (WDI) in the Directorate General Communications (DG/C). We are responsible for the ECB’s digital communications, including website development, design and content; digital content creation; social-media channel management; publications; visual communications including photo, video, design, and branding; and digital impact analysis.

In your role as a Multimedia trainee, you will be part of the ECB’s Multimedia team, which is responsible for producing photo, video and other innovative audio-visual solutions for a number of platforms (including web, social etc.), and will work closely with both internal and external stakeholders. Your role

Your tasks as a trainee in the Multimedia team will include: 

  • supporting the duties of the ECB’s official photographer and videographer;
  • developing audio-visual storytelling solutions that support communication objectives and meet the aims of creative briefs;
  • searching for images and video footage that best match ECB-related topics, across all platforms and communication channels, including websites and social media; 
  • making complex topics accessible to the general public by creatively combining text, images, videos and other audio-visual footage;
  • organising raw media, colour grading footage and archiving media files as required with the necessary meta tags.
